The Future Of Software Development: Ai-Driven Code And Automation

The Future Of Software Development: Ai-Driven Code And Automation Imagine a world where you effortlessly glide thru the development process, with artificial intelligence (AI) and automation handling the tedious tasks that once consumed your valuable time. As a developer, you could focus on the bigger picture while AI-driven code generation and automated debugging tools work…


Rev Up Your Software Development: Devops Strategies Driving Harrogate’s Success

Rev Up Your Software Development: Devops Strategies Driving Harrogate’s Success Are you looking to take your software development process to the next level? Harrogate, a pioneer in the tech industry, has been reaping the benefits of implementing successful DevOps strategies. By harnessing the power of collaboration, automation, continuous integration and deployment, as well as monitoring…


Harrogate: Enhancing Business Modules With Customised Software Solutions

Harrogate: Enhancing Business Modules With Customised Software Solutions In the ever-evolving landscape of business, staying ahead of the curve is essential for success. And when it comes to enhancing your business modules with customised software solutions, Harrogate is the name you can trust. Just like a master chef expertly crafts each ingredient to create a…

Software Development is a dynamic and exciting field that is constantly evolving, presenting new challenges and opportunities at each turn. In simple terms, it’s the process of creating, designing, deploying, and maintaining software. However, in reality, the scope is much more expansive. It includes research, new development, prototyping, modification, reuse, re-engineering, maintenance and other activities that result in the creation of software products.

The demand for bespoke software, apps, and web development has seen a steep rise over the past decade. There’s no one-size-fits-all approach when it comes to software. Each organisation, from startups to established corporations, has unique requirements, necessitating a tailored approach. An off-the-shelf software might not accommodate these unique functionalities and could potentially impose curb on creativity and efficiency.

Software Developers today leverage a range of in-demand programming languages such as Java, Python, and JavaScript, adopting leading industry methodologies such as Agile, DevOps, and Continuous Delivery. Rapid advancements in cloud computing, artificial intelligence, and big data analytics are creating new paradigms in software development, challenging developers to acquire new skills and adapt to changing technological landscapes.

According to a report from Evans Data, there are currently around 26.4 million software developers in the world, a testament to the global demand for software solutions. Interestingly, this number is projected to increase to 28.7 million by 2024, as per the same report, highlighting the importance and growth trajectory of the software development industry.

Investopedia states that the global IT market, encapsulating all software, is predicted to reach a staggering $5.2 trillion by 2022. Business enterprises alone have contributed to over $2 billion in spending on cloud-based software development services. Such impressive numbers point to the burgeoning demand for software development and the myriad opportunities yet to be capitalised on.

Software not only transforms how businesses operate but also significantly affect our daily lives. From apps that help monitor health or manage finances to software that powers our favourite video games, the impact and possibilities of software development are endless.

Well-conceived and developed software can be a game-changer, providing organisations with the competitive edge they need. By understanding their unique needs and developing custom solutions, companies can unlock new levels of efficiency, productivity, and ultimately, success.

For in-depth insights into the world of Software Development, I encourage you to explore the Software Development section of our blog. For a broader understanding regarding technology trends, innovations and interesting discussions within the digital sphere, feel free to browse our Blog. If you wish to discuss your unique software needs or share your thoughts, we at Harrogate Apps would love to hear from you.

See our blog categories.